Class ParametricEquationRenderer
-
- All Implemented Interfaces:
-
com.skillw.particlelib.pobject.Playable
public final class ParametricEquationRenderer extends ParticleObject implements Playable
表示一个参数方程渲染器
Zoyn
-
-
Constructor Summary
Constructors Constructor Description ParametricEquationRenderer(Location origin, Function<Double, Double> xFunction, Function<Double, Double> yFunction, Double minT, Double maxT, Double dT)参数方程渲染器, 自动将z方程变为0 ParametricEquationRenderer(Location origin, Function<Double, Double> xFunction, Function<Double, Double> yFunction, Function<Double, Double> zFunction, Double minT, Double maxT, Double deltaT)
-
Method Summary
Modifier and Type Method Description final Function<Double, Double>getXFunction()final Function<Double, Double>getYFunction()final Function<Double, Double>getZFunction()final DoublegetMinT()final UnitsetMinT(Double minT)final DoublegetMaxT()final UnitsetMaxT(Double maxT)final DoublegetDeltaT()final UnitsetDeltaT(Double deltaT)Unitshow()Unitplay()UnitplayNextPoint()-
-
Constructor Detail
-
ParametricEquationRenderer
ParametricEquationRenderer(Location origin, Function<Double, Double> xFunction, Function<Double, Double> yFunction, Double minT, Double maxT, Double dT)
参数方程渲染器, 自动将z方程变为0- Parameters:
origin- 原点xFunction- x函数yFunction- y函数
-
ParametricEquationRenderer
ParametricEquationRenderer(Location origin, Function<Double, Double> xFunction, Function<Double, Double> yFunction, Function<Double, Double> zFunction, Double minT, Double maxT, Double deltaT)
- Parameters:
origin- 原点xFunction- x函数yFunction- y函数zFunction- z函数minT- 自变量最小值maxT- 自变量最大值deltaT- 每次自变量所增加的量
-
-
Method Detail
-
getXFunction
final Function<Double, Double> getXFunction()
-
getYFunction
final Function<Double, Double> getYFunction()
-
getZFunction
final Function<Double, Double> getZFunction()
-
playNextPoint
Unit playNextPoint()
-
-
-
-